Carbon Dioxide Pipeline Projects Face Regulatory Hurdles Amid Growing Interest in Carbon Capture
Safety and environmental risks of CO2 pipelines emerge as key challenges for carbon capture projects.

The growing interest in carbon capture and storage (CCS) projects to address atmospheric emissions has drawn attention to the crucial role of pipelines in transporting carbon dioxide (CO2) to sequestration sites, highlighting concerns over safety issues. Key Takeaways
- Iowa regulators have approved Summit Carbon Solutions LLC’s proposed carbon dioxide pipeline project designed to transport CO2 from over 50 ethanol plants across five states and channel it to North Dakota for underground storage.
- A referendum asking voters to consider recent South Dakota legislation on CO2 pipeline regulations has been validated for the November election.
- Illinois lawmakers have passed legislation on carbon capture and storage including a pause on CO2 pipelines until July 2026 or until the Pipeline and Hazardous Materials Safety Administration finalizes its rules.
